
Nitacure 200mg Tablet
Marketer
Alembic Pharmaceuticals Ltd
Salt Composition
Nitazoxanide (200mg)

How to use Nitacure 200mg Tablet:
Follow your doctor's instructions precisely regarding dosage and treatment length for this medication. Ingest the 200mg Nitacure t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or breaking it. Administer this medication with food.
How Nitacure 200mg Tablet works:
Nitazoxanide, an antiparasitic drug, disrupts the parasite's vital processes by blocking the synthesis of key metabolic compounds necessary for its survival and proliferation.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Alcohol consumption alongside Nitacure 200mg Tablet may be unsafe; se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Nitacure 200mg tablets during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als have revealed minimal or no harmful effects on fetal development; nevertheless, clinical data from human studies remain scarce.
Breast feedingCAUTION
The use of Nitacure 200mg tablets while breastfeeding requires careful consideration. Breastfeeding is advised against until the mother's treatment concludes and the medication is fully cleared from her system. Infants of mothers using Nitacure 200mg tablets should be observed for any signs of diarrhea.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king a 200mg Nitacure tablet might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Insufficient data exists regarding the administration of Nitacure 200mg tablets to individuals with renal impairment. Seek medical advice from your physician.
Li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Insufficient data exists regarding the administration of Nitacure 200mg tablets to individuals with hepatic impairment. Seek medical advice from your physician.
